Biography and Research Information
OverviewAI-generated summary
Dieu Doan's research focuses on food allergies, food insecurity, and related health outcomes in children. Doan has investigated the diet quality of children with multiple food allergies in Arkansas and the implementation of early peanut introduction among providers in the southern United States. Additionally, Doan has explored the efficacy and safety of baked milk oral immunotherapy in children with severe milk allergy through a Phase 2 trial. Other research interests include the feasibility and effectiveness of telemedicine home assessments for identifying asthma triggers, particularly in rural areas, and the evaluation of recurrent warts, which led to the identification of GATA2 deficiency in a case study. Doan's work also addresses the broader societal issue of food insecurity and its connection to allergic diseases, advocating for collective action.
